Handover note — Crumbwheel order cutoffs.

Welcome aboard. The bakery cutoff rule in Crumbwheel closes same-day orders at 14:00 local to each storefront, not UTC — this has bitten us twice. Holiday overrides live in the calendar service and take precedence silently, so always check there first when a cutoff looks wrong. To unlock the calendar service's admin console after a restart, enter the recovery passphrase below.

vault phrase of bagap-bahaf = silion-pelox-sorox-casdor-quenwyn-fraax-eliox-praael-kelion-quenvan-kasox-rusael-norius-belvan

Day one: show the new starter the goods lift at the rear of Calloway Court. Lift is for deliveries only — no passenger use, no exceptions. Couriers call reception from the dock intercom; log every delivery in the red binder. The lift holds on each floor until the inner gate is closed, so remind drivers to shut it properly. If the lift is left open and blocks a delivery, reception can release it remotely. To do that, enter the release code below.

turnstile pass: bdg-FVNQRS-72965873

Break-Glass Access: Fernwick Bloom Layer. The bloom filter fronting the Larkstone key-value store suppresses lookups for absent keys. If the filter corrupts and begins false-negating, reads silently miss live data; break-glass disables the filter cluster-wide. Only the release manager may invoke this during a release window. Authenticate to the break-glass console with the passphrase below.

vault phrase of taweg-kafof = oliax-zorael